Tasting Notes
Robert KarlssonInitially a bit on the thin side. Then a malty sweetened smokiness and citrus. Turns more on leathery notes with time. Tobacco? The taste is a bit surprisingly more on a rather obvious berried vanilla. That along the smoke makes it a treat. When sampled again another day (and from another bottle) it was ultra-sulphury on gunpowder (not rotten eggs). Very strange that it was not found previously. Still good though (88p).
